About Daniel

I was pleased and privileged to be elected as the Member of Parliament for Shrewsbury & Atcham in 2005 and have been committed to working hard for all my constituents in the years since then. I am honoured to have been re-elected in 2010, 2015, 2017 and most recently in 2019.

I was brought up in Surrey, before going to Stirling University to study Business Studies with French and Spanish. I then worked in telecommunications for ten years as an international account manager, travelling extensively in Europe, the Middle East and Africa. I have lived in Shrewsbury since becoming an MP in 2005.   

In previous parliamentary terms, I have been on the Foreign Affairs Select Committee; was the Parliamentary Private Secretary to the Secretary of State for Wales and was also appointed the Prime Minister's Envoy to the Polish and Eastern European Diaspora in the United Kingdom. 

I am currently Trade Envoy to Mongolia and am actively involved in a number of All-Party Parliamentary Groups.
